Common Performance Mods and Their Costs

  • Cold Air Intake: $300 – $700
  • Exhaust System: $500 – $1,200
  • Tune: $300 – $600
  • Suspension Upgrades: $500 – $1,500
  • Brake Upgrades: $400 – $1,000
  • Wheels and Tires: $800 – $2,000

Cold Air Intake

A cold air intake system allows the engine to breathe better, improving performance and efficiency. Installation costs for a cold air intake can range from $100 to $300, depending on the complexity of the installation and the specific kit chosen.

Exhaust System

Upgrading the exhaust system can enhance engine performance and provide a more aggressive sound. The cost of an aftermarket exhaust system can vary widely based on the brand and material used, with installation typically costing between $200 and $500.

Tuning

A performance tune can optimize engine parameters for better power delivery and efficiency. The costs for tuning services can range from $300 to $600, depending on whether it’s a simple reflash or a more complex custom tune.

Suspension Upgrades

Upgrading the suspension can drastically improve handling and ride quality. Options include coilovers, sway bars, and performance shocks. Installation costs for suspension upgrades can range from $300 to $800, with the total cost including parts potentially reaching $1,500 or more.

Brake Upgrades

Improving braking performance is essential for high-performance driving. Upgrades can include better pads, rotors, and calipers. Costs for brake upgrades can range from $400 to $1,000, depending on the components selected and installation complexity.

Wheels and Tires

Wheels and tires not only affect aesthetics but also performance. Upgrading to lightweight wheels and high-performance tires can enhance handling and reduce unsprung weight. The total cost for wheels and tires can range from $800 to $2,000, depending on the brand and specifications.

Labor Costs

Labor costs for installation can vary based on the shop’s hourly rate and the complexity of the modifications. Typically, labor rates can range from $75 to $150 per hour. It’s essential to factor in these costs when budgeting for performance upgrades.
